| Using
Color Samplers |
There is a
somewhat troublesome issue in the Fifo, the
color samplers are only accurate when they are visible in the Preview
box. So, in order to use functions that take the advantage
of the samplers one has to:
- zoom up.
- Place the
sampler(s).
- zoom down
if needed.
- And
never drag the image so that a sampler gets out of the preview
box.
It is a limitation
surely but does not completely hinder the usage of the samplers,
one just has to remember this issue.

| Using
Color Samplers when there are two or more of them |
FiFo filter
can have up to 6 color samplers. The number of the active sampler
is shown in the option boxes below the preview-box.
Now, the Option
boxes of the samplers will auto increment when new samplers are
inserted.
In case one
has e.g. two samplers (say sampler n:o 1 as the Black-point sampler
and sampler n:o2 as then White-point sampler) then the first right-click
will drop the sampler number 1... and the second right-click will
drop the sampler number 2. And then the next right-click will drop
the sampler number 1 again (so changes it's location) and so on.
Therefore,
in order to move (re-place) or remove a sampler, first select the
option button of that sampler, then right-click.

| Buttons |
Note that the
Reset-button only
resets the sliders. It does not:
- remove color-samplers
- reset the
check-boxes
- reset selection
dropdown.
Fifo remembers
it's settings so therefore, when you re-enter into the filter dialog,
things may not be as expected even after hitting the Reset button.
Depending on the function that e.g. the check-boxes are controlling
the Preview may appear very strangely. So, check the three settings.
